Road cycling routes around Millvale offer access to an extensive network of paved paths and varied terrain. The region is characterized by its location along the Allegheny River, providing scenic riverfront views and connections to major trail systems like the Three Rivers Heritage Trail. Cyclists can find routes that traverse flat riverfront paths or include climbs up local streets and the Allegheny Plateau. This area serves as a hub for accessing numerous other paved and crushed stone trails, suitable for…

Springdale is a small borough along the Allegheny River, about 15 miles northeast of Pittsburgh. Best known as the birthplace of environmentalist Rachel Carson, the town honors her legacy with the Rachel Carson Homestead, where she spent her early years. Though largely residential, Springdale has a few local restaurants and shops, making it a convenient overnight stop for hikers on the Rachel Carson Trail or those exploring the area. The town sits at a transitional point along the long distance trail, where wooded hills give way to more developed stretches, and offers a quiet, practical place enter/exit the trail.

The Hot Metal Bridge is one of the most recognizable landmarks along the GAP. It crosses the Monongahela River and was an important bridge during the city's industrial heyday. Now, it is a great place to cross by bike and get a wonderful view of the city and river below.

There are nearly 150 road cycling routes around Millvale, offering a diverse range of experiences for cyclists. These routes are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 50 reviews.
Road cycling routes in Millvale offer varied terrain. You can find flat, paved riverfront paths along the Allegheny River, as well as routes that include climbs up local streets like Washington Street or Parker Street for those seeking more elevation. The region provides a mix of natural beauty and urban landscapes.
Yes, Millvale offers nearly 40 easy road cycling routes perfect for beginners or those looking for a relaxed ride. Many of these routes utilize paved paths along the riverfront, such as sections of the North Shore Trail and the Three Rivers Heritage Trail, which are suitable for all fitness levels.
For more challenging rides, Millvale has over 20 difficult routes that can extend up to five hours with 1500 feet of elevation gain. These routes may include steeper climbs and varied surfaces. An example of a moderate route with significant elevation is the Three Rivers Heritage Trail and Sewickley Loop, which covers nearly 50 miles with over 700 meters of ascent.
Road cycling in Millvale is particularly popular in June and July. During these months, the weather is generally favorable for exploring the extensive network of paths and trails, from riverfront routes to urban climbs.
Yes, many of the easy, paved riverfront trails are suitable for families. Routes like those along the North Shore Trail or sections of the Three Rivers Heritage Trail offer safe and scenic environments for cyclists of all ages. These paths often provide views of the Pittsburgh skyline and are relatively flat.
Many routes offer impressive views of the Pittsburgh skyline, especially from bridges like the Hot Metal Bridge. You can also explore historic industrial landmarks such as the Homestead Pump House along the Great Allegheny Passage. Riverfront views along the Allegheny River are a constant feature of many rides.
Yes, there are several circular road cycling routes. For instance, the Hot Metal Bridge – Three Rivers Heritage Trail loop from Allegheny County is a moderate 19.2-mile circular path offering views of the Pittsburgh skyline and the Monongahela River. Another option is the View of the Andy Warhol Bridge – Andy Warhol Bridge loop from Perry South, an 11.3-mile easy loop.
Millvale Riverfront Park often serves as a convenient starting point for many cycling adventures and connects to the broader trail network. This park is a good place to look for parking before heading out on your ride.

Beyond the scenic riverfronts and skyline views, you can encounter several landmarks. The Hot Metal Bridge is a recognizable feature along the Great Allegheny Passage. The Homestead Pump House offers a glimpse into Pittsburgh's industrial heritage. For sports fans, Acrisure Stadium is also nearby.
While Millvale is primarily known for its riverfront trails, some routes or nearby areas can lead to natural features. For example, Panther Hollow Lake is a nearby attraction, and the Beechwood Farms Nature Reserve is also in the vicinity, offering a different natural experience.
